We then wandered around and found a cave entrance in a shopping centre! So we went for an explore down there, which was an interesting if not very festival-like way to spend an afternoon XD I never knew that Nottingham was based on sandstone that the residents carved out to make extra space in their houses or make cellars, among many other things, but I learnt a lot about it while we went round underneath the shopping centre!

Ye Olde Trip to Jerusalem
We moved onto more expected things- the pub! We went to 'Ye Olde Trip to Jerusalem', the oldest pub in England. It was really interesting as we went round the place and read all the little plaques about it's history, and wandered into all the rooms, many of them dug out of the sandstone cliff the pub was rested against.
